Risk management and solvency: mathematical methods in theory and practice

The paper gives a survey of the development status of the Solvency II process and compares several European standard models. Specific attention is given to the risk based German standard model developed by the GDV (German Insurance Association) and the BaFin (Federal Financial Supervisory Authority). The dependences between risks play an essential role in Solvency II since their negligence can lead to a substantial misestimation of the solvency capital. This is particularly critical when looking at natural catastrophes where dependencies can occur due to close regional distances or climatic triggers. Also, when looking at the risk measures Value at Risk and Expected Shortfall it becomes apparent how strong the influence of the underlying dependence structure is, even in the case of uncorrelated risks. On the basis of these considerations, established dependence structures as copulas, linear correlation, rank correlation, and dependencies in the tail are explicitly examined. Furthermore, a new approach which essentially consists in an approximation of the underlying copula by certain grid type copulas is introduced, for which the distribution of the sum of arbitrarily many risks can be calculated explicitly.
